The Benefits of 3D Printing in Dentistry
With the SprintRay® 3D printer, we’re able to create custom dental devices with exceptional accuracy and speed. Whether it’s a dental model, crown, bridge, or even a surgical guide for implant placement, the 3D printer provides us with the ability to produce these items quickly and precisely. The result? Less waiting time and a more comfortable treatment process for you.
3D printing also reduces the margin of error that can occur with traditional methods, ensuring that your dental restoration fits. With this technology, we can also create more detailed and precise models for treatments like orthodontics or smile design.

Am I a Good Candidate for 3D Printing?
3D printing is ideal for patients needing custom dental restorations, such as crowns, bridges, dentures, or nightguards. It’s also beneficial for patients undergoing implant treatments or those needing orthodontic devices like retainers.
